Manhattan Micro Apartment

Posted on December 22, 2012 by kcalderon0612 • Leave a comment

What will $700 get you in Manhattan?…… 90 square feet. By choosing a studio that measures just 12 feet by 7 feet, Felice Cohen can afford to live in Manhattan’s Upper West Side where apartments rent for an average of $3,600 per month.
